在當今數(shù)字化時代,網(wǎng)頁制作已成為每一個企業(yè)和個人展示自我的重要途徑。無論是簡單的個人博客,還是復(fù)雜的企業(yè)官網(wǎng),網(wǎng)頁的設(shè)計和功能都直接影響到用戶體驗和商業(yè)效果。本文將深入探討網(wǎng)頁制作作品源代碼的內(nèi)涵、重要性以及一些實用技巧,幫助讀者更好地理解和應(yīng)用這一領(lǐng)域的知識。

一、網(wǎng)頁制作的基礎(chǔ)概念

網(wǎng)頁制作不僅僅是設(shè)計美觀的頁面,它還涉及到用戶體驗、功能實現(xiàn)和內(nèi)容管理。理解網(wǎng)頁的基本構(gòu)成元素至關(guān)重要。網(wǎng)頁的核心技術(shù)主要包括HTML(超文本標記語言)、CSS(層疊樣式表)JavaScript(腳本語言)。

  1. HTML:負責網(wǎng)頁的結(jié)構(gòu)和內(nèi)容。例如,標題、段落、鏈接和圖像都通過HTML標記實現(xiàn)。掌握HTML能幫助你構(gòu)建網(wǎng)頁的基礎(chǔ)框架。

  2. CSS:負責網(wǎng)頁的視覺表現(xiàn)。通過CSS,你可以設(shè)置字體、顏色、間距等樣式,使網(wǎng)頁更具吸引力。

  3. JavaScript:負責網(wǎng)頁的交互功能。它使得網(wǎng)頁能夠響應(yīng)用戶的操作,例如點擊按鈕后出現(xiàn)提示框、動態(tài)更改內(nèi)容等。

掌握這些基礎(chǔ)知識后,你可以開始著手于網(wǎng)頁制作作品源代碼的編寫。

二、了解源代碼的重要性

源代碼是網(wǎng)頁的靈魂。它不僅決定了網(wǎng)頁的功能和樣式,也對搜索引擎優(yōu)化(SEO)有著直接影響。通過優(yōu)化代碼,可以提高網(wǎng)頁在搜索引擎中的排名,從而吸引更多訪問者。

1. 網(wǎng)頁的加載速度

采用精簡高效的源代碼結(jié)構(gòu)能夠顯著提高網(wǎng)頁的加載速度,這是用戶體驗的重要因素。使用壓縮和合并CSS、JavaScript文件,刪除不必要的注釋和空格,可以有效減少文件大小,從而加快加載時間。

2. 響應(yīng)式設(shè)計

現(xiàn)代網(wǎng)頁設(shè)計越來越重視響應(yīng)式布局,以適應(yīng)不同設(shè)備的屏幕尺寸。通過使用CSS媒體查詢,你可以根據(jù)設(shè)備的特性自適應(yīng)調(diào)整網(wǎng)頁布局,確保無論是在手機、平板還是電腦上,用戶都能獲得良好的瀏覽體驗。

3. 搜索引擎優(yōu)化

在編寫網(wǎng)頁所需的源代碼時,合理使用標簽、屬性和關(guān)鍵詞是提升SEO的重要環(huán)節(jié)。例如,在HTML文檔中使用<title>、<meta>標簽可以幫助搜索引擎更好地理解網(wǎng)頁內(nèi)容。此外,合理使用alt屬性描述圖像,有助于搜索引擎抓取和識別。

三、實用的網(wǎng)頁制作技巧

在實際網(wǎng)頁制作過程中,大家常常會遇到各種各樣的挑戰(zhàn)。以下是一些實用的技巧,有助于提高網(wǎng)頁的制作效率和質(zhì)量。

1. 使用框架和庫

利用現(xiàn)有的前端框架(如Bootstrap、Foundation)和JavaScript庫(如jQuery、React)可以大大簡化開發(fā)流程。這些工具不僅提供了現(xiàn)成的組件和樣式,還能幫助你快速實現(xiàn)響應(yīng)式設(shè)計和動態(tài)交互。

2. 編寫可維護的代碼

良好的代碼結(jié)構(gòu)不僅能提高工作效率,還能方便日后的維護。建議遵循命名規(guī)范、添加注釋,并分模塊編寫功能,確保代碼的可讀性和可維護性。

3. 定期測試與優(yōu)化

在網(wǎng)頁完成后,一定要進行多次的測試,包括功能測試、兼容性測試以及性能測試。使用瀏覽器的開發(fā)者工具可以幫助你檢查網(wǎng)頁的運行情況,并提出改進建議。此外,定期優(yōu)化代碼和更新內(nèi)容也是保持網(wǎng)頁競爭力的重要措施。

四、總結(jié)

網(wǎng)頁制作作品源代碼的編寫是一個復(fù)雜而又富有創(chuàng)造性的過程。通過合理的技術(shù)運用和優(yōu)化策略,你可以創(chuàng)建出既美觀又實用的網(wǎng)頁。從基礎(chǔ)知識到實際技巧,無論是個人還是企業(yè),掌握網(wǎng)頁制作的核心元素將為你帶來更廣闊的發(fā)展空間。希望通過本文的探討,能夠激發(fā)你在網(wǎng)頁制作方面的靈感,提升創(chuàng)作水平。